Transaction 84c61ede53c510607f63733f51999c815605154d6518fcc114cf6f171ec7cf22
1 Input
1 Output
-
84c61ede53c510607f63733f51999c815605154d6518fcc114cf6f171ec7cf22:0
- value
- 2802555
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7afeeaaf6b51943e7e5ddb56cff3e9daaf889ed
- address
- bc1q77h7a2hkk5v58el9mk6kele7nk403z0d4mu3t8